Comprehending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electrically powered devices created for individuals with restricted mobility. They supply a method of transportation for people who might have trouble strolling but still wish to keep their self-reliance. They are available in different styles and functions to cater to a large variety of requirements.

The choice of mobility scooter frequently depends on the features that align with private needs. Here are a few of the key functions to think about:

Weight Capacity: Mobility scooters include different weight limits. It is important to select a scooter that can sufficiently support the user's weight.

Range: The range a scooter can travel on a single charge varies. Depending upon user requirements, one might go with scooters with a series of up to 40 miles.

Speed: Most mobility scooters can reach speeds in between 4 to 8 miles per hour. Consider what speed is comfortable and safe for the desired environment.

Turning Radius: A compact turning radius is necessary for indoor usage, allowing for simpler navigation in tight spaces.

Battery Type: The type of batteries used can impact the scooter's performance. Lead-acid and lithium-ion batteries are the most common.
Advantages of Using Mobility Scooters
The benefits of mobility scooters extend beyond simply transport. Some crucial advantages include:

Independence: Users can navigate their environment without counting on caregivers, promoting independence and self-esteem.

Health Benefits: Using a scooter can motivate outdoor activity, leading to physical and mental health improvements by decreasing feelings of seclusion.

Convenience: Scooters can easily be run in numerous environments, whether indoors, in mall, or outdoors.
Important Considerations When Buying a Mobility Scooter
When purchasing a mobility scooter, a number of considerations can assist make sure that you choose the ideal model:

Assess Individual Needs:
Mobility level: Consider how much assistance the person will require.Variety of use: Determine where the scooter will primarily be used (inside your home, outdoors, on rough terrains, etc).
Test Drive:
Always test drive numerous models to discover an appropriate fit. Take note of comfort, ease of steering, and the scooter's responsiveness.
Review Safety Features:
Look for scooters with sufficient security features like lights, indicators, and anti-tip designs.
Inspect Warranty and Service Options:
